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65473318 96709370 2248917119
703701287 80887171589 049110199
703701287 80887171589 049110199
653072225 7316 218029
All about undefined
Interested in learning more?
703701287 80887171589 049110199
653072225 7316 218029
See more
28 893 2904
58200 7800 0055426
See more
5275694478 1306488830
786 75477065 104531 294152992
See more